《电子技术应用》
您所在的位置:首页 > 嵌入式技术 > 业界动态 > 飞思卡尔突破架构界限 QE128让设计更加灵活

飞思卡尔突破架构界限 QE128让设计更加灵活

2008-10-17
作者:周 鑫

    嵌入式系统设计行业正在发生变化,同一位开发人员经常需要设计具有不同性能的系列终端产品,以适应多样的市场需求。为了迎接挑战,飞思卡尔" title="飞思卡尔">飞思卡尔日前推出了两种新的FlexisTM系列微控制器" title="微控制器">微控制器(MCU),在8位与32位产品兼容性方面取得了新的突破。
    基于S08内核的MC9S08QE128和基于ColdFire?誖 V1内核的MCF51QE128是针脚兼容的8位与32位微控制器,而且采用相同片上外围设备和开发工具" title="开发工具">开发工具。其中,MCF51QE128是业内首款基于ColdFire?誖 V1内核的器件。开发人员可以采用Flexis QE128系列在低端和高性能嵌入式设计之间灵活移植。

 

独特的兼容架构路线图


    今天的开发人员需要利用相同的主板设计、软件代码和开发工具将简单的8位住宅安全控制系统扩展到先进的32位商业安全控制系统,或者将基本的家用血压监测仪升级为高级的医用血压监测仪。
    基于类似原因,那些采用8 位设备的开发者为了获得更好的性能和更多的外设,需要采用价格经济的32位MCU。但是,在不同的处理器架构间实现无缝平移并非易事,通常需要花费大量的时间重新编写代码,并投入昂贵的开发工具费用。
    针对这一需求,飞思卡尔半导体提供了一条更加简便的路线来完成从8位到32位微控制器的无缝切换。
    为了帮助设计人员以最好的价格找到性能最合适的解决方案,飞思卡尔创建了Controller Continuum,如图1所示。

 

 

    Controller Continuum消除了传统的比特位界限,使飞思卡尔的8位微控制器可以轻松地与更高性能的32位ColdFire器件相互移植。设计人员可以利用8位和32位MCU所共用的软件和硬件开发工具开发新的应用,并且随着产品的成熟,它们还可以更加轻松地升级到下一代产品。

 

8位到32位处理器的连接点


    飞思卡尔通过Controller Continuum向广大开发人员提供了一条清晰的移植路径,Flexis QE128 MCU为消费电子和工业应用带来了无尽的可能性,其中包括医疗仪器与监控、工厂自动化、销售点设备、消防与安全系统、HVAC与楼宇控制、计量与消费电子产品等。互相兼容的体系结构和工具使企业不需要大量投资改写软件和转换到新的体系结构,就可以轻松进军新的嵌入式市场。对于不同产品设计的拓展性需求,开发人员不再需要重新开发一个低或高端设计,他们只需要转换针脚兼容的8位或32位Flexis MCU,然后使用相同的CodeWarrior Development Studio软件重新编写代码。
    Flexis QE128 MCU所采用的RS08内核是飞思卡尔S08中央处理单元的缩小版本(缩小30%)。RS08是专门为针脚较少的器件设计的,内存小于16KB,效率和成本效益更高。其针对向完全固体电子操作转移的简单电机器件,或者尺寸不断缩小的便携产品,甚至一次性产品。当需要额外的功能时,可以升级到针脚兼容的S08产品。
    当不断增长的需求超出了8位处理器的能力水平时,客户可以把他们的应用移植到针脚兼容的ColdFire V1器件,而且不必修改其目标板或者开发环境。V1内核和S08内核常用的外围模块包括振荡器时钟、内部时钟源、模数转换器、I2C以及串行通讯接口。

 

低功耗" title="低功耗">低功耗与易用性的结合


    随着普通消费与工业设备变得越来越小、越来越先进和便于携带,提高功效和延长电池使用时间成了关键的要求。Flexis QE128设备可通过降低运行电压和电流的优化外设来满足这些要求。
    Flexis QE128微控制器使用业界领先的超低功耗" title="超低功耗">超低功耗特性来最大限度地降低运行成本,延长电池使用时间。MC9S08QE128与MCF51QE128外配一个32kHz、消耗电流小于1?滋A的可编程振荡器。同时,Flexis QE器件具备一个内部电压调节器,帮助系统从停止模式下快速唤醒,唤醒时间一般为6?滋s。Flexis QE128设备在停止模式下的功耗非常低,停止模式下最低功耗所需的电流为370nA。时钟门控可关闭时钟,这样可以进一步降低运行模式下的功耗33%。
    这些超低功耗特性使嵌入式设备开发人员可以充分利用Flexis QE128系列的兼容性优点,同时确保设备的低功耗,甚至在升级至32位设备时也是如此。这对下一代电池供电设备至关重要。
    为了简化主板设计,飞思卡尔提供功能齐全的EVBQE128评价板、经济高效的DEMOQE演示板和多种参考设计及应用注释。同时,飞思卡尔还将通过使用虚拟实验室和网络广播来帮助开发人员学习如何使用Flexis QE128器件设计产品。

 

Flexis QE128产品的特性

  • MC9S08QE128:第一款带128 KB闪存的8位S08 MCU;
  • MCF51QE128:第一款32位ColdFire V1 MCU和业界最高效的32位控制器;
  • 停止电流降至370nA;
  • 6us唤醒时间;
  • 超低运行电流起始于50micro-amps,50MHz S08或ColdFire V1内核运行频率;
  • 25MHz的总线频率;
  • 最大8KB的RAM;
  • 最高128KB的闪存;
  • 24信道的12位模数转换器(ADC);
  • 两个模拟比较器;
  • 2×SCI、2×I2C、2×SPI 一个6信道和两个3信道的定时器PWM模块;
  • 实时时钟(RTC);
  • 最多70路通用输入/输出(GPIO);
  • 系统集成:频率锁定环(FLL)和软件看门狗;
  • 内部时钟源(ICS);
  • 低功耗外部32kHz振荡器;
  • 电压范围为1.8V~3.6V;
  • 增强型内部振荡器、电压调节器和实时计数器;
  • 封装:80LQFP、64LQFP;
  • 温度范围:-40℃~+85℃;
  • 通用开发工具,包括CodeWarrior for Microcontrollers 6.0。
本站内容除特别声明的原创文章之外,转载内容只为传递更多信息,并不代表本网站赞同其观点。转载的所有的文章、图片、音/视频文件等资料的版权归版权所有权人所有。本站采用的非本站原创文章及图片等内容无法一一联系确认版权者。如涉及作品内容、版权和其它问题,请及时通过电子邮件或电话通知我们,以便迅速采取适当措施,避免给双方造成不必要的经济损失。联系电话:010-82306118;邮箱:aet@chinaaet.com。